虚拟币交易是指在不同平台上买卖数字资产(如比特币、以太坊等)的过程。交易者通过分析市场趋势,决定何时买入或卖出,旨在获取利润。
#### 虚拟币交易接口的概念虚拟币交易接口,通常称为API(应用程序接口),是系统之间进行交互的标准化协议。在虚拟币交易中,API允许用户自动化他们的交易,并获取实时市场数据。
### 虚拟币交易接口的重要性 #### 交易接口的功能交易接口为用户提供了几种功能,如获取市场行情、执行买卖指令、查询账户余额等。通过接口,交易者能够在毫秒级别做出交易决策,大幅提升交易效率。
#### 安全性与可靠性高质量的虚拟币交易接口会提供更好的安全性,减少交易过程中的风险。用户在选择交易平台时,必须关注接口的安全性和稳定性,以确保资产安全。
### 如何寻找合适的虚拟币交易接口 #### 研究和对比不同交易平台为了找到最适合自己的交易接口,用户需要研究不同的虚拟币交易平台,比较其功能、费用、执行速度等因素。
#### 用户评价与反馈用户的反馈和评价可以为新用户提供重要的参考,帮助他们识别哪些平台的接口更值得信赖。
### 主流虚拟币交易平台的交易接口 #### Binance的API概述Binance是全球最大的虚拟货币交易所之一,其API功能强大、文档完善。交易者可以通过其接口进行高频交易,获取市场数据等。
#### Coinbase的接口利用Coinbase提供易于使用的API,适合初学者。虽然功能不及Binance丰富,但也支持基本的交易和市场数据查询。
#### Kraken与Bitfinex的特点Kraken与Bitfinex也是用户选择的热门平台。两者的API配置相对复杂,但功能全面。通过这些平台,交易者能够执行更高级的交易策略。
### 如何使用虚拟币交易接口进行交易 #### API密钥的生成与管理使用交易接口的第一步是生成API密钥。交易平台通常提供简单的界面来管理API密钥,确保这些信息的安全至关重要。
#### 代码实例:如何实现基本交易这个部分将提供一个Python代码示例,展示如何使用交易接口进行低频交易。用户可以根据自己的需求修改该代码。
### 交易接口常见问题解答 #### API调用限制大多数交易平台都会对API的调用频率设置限制。了解这些限制可以帮助用户避免因频繁请求而被封禁。
#### 错误处理在使用API进行交易时,用户可能会遇到各种错误。在这一部分,我们将探讨常见错误及其解决方案。
### 安全性与合规性 #### 防范攻击与交易诈骗虚拟币交易存在一定的风险,用户需了解如何识别和防范潜在的网络攻击和诈骗行为。
#### 各国的合规要求不同国家对虚拟币交易的法律法规不同,了解这些要求有助于用户合法合规地进行交易。
### 未来趋势 #### 虚拟币交易接口的进化随着区块链技术的不断发展,未来的交易接口将会更加智能、高效,并且具备更多创新功能。
#### 对开发者的挑战与机会随着虚拟币市场的成长,开发者在设计和交易接口上将面临更多挑战,但同时也会迎来更多机遇。
--- ### 六个相关问题及详尽介绍 #### 1. 虚拟币交易接口如何影响交易决策?虚拟币交易接口通过提供实时数据帮助交易者做出及时决策。在竞争激烈的市场中,数据的时效性在整个交易决策中扮演了关键角色。
实时数据如价格波动、市场深度和成交量等,可以通过API迅速获取。这样,交易者可以更好地把握市场动态,降低决策时间,快速响应市场变化。
例如,如果一个交易者通过API看到某个币种的价格瞬间上涨,可以立马选择买入,锁定盈利。反之,如果价格急剧下跌,交易者也可以选择快速卖出,减少损失。通过自动化的API系统,交易者在面对复杂的市场瞬息万变时能够更从容地作出响应。
此外,交易接口的灵活性也允许交易者根据历史数据、技术分析进行算法交易。在量化交易中,交易策略往往依赖于API以毫秒级的速度执行指令,最大化盈利机会。
#### 2. 如何确保虚拟币交易接口的安全性?确保虚拟币交易接口的安全性是每位交易者的首要任务。为了保护自己的资产,交易者应采取多种有效的安全措施。
首先,使用强密码和双重验证(2FA)是必要的第一步。创建复杂的API密钥,并定期更换,可以减少被黑客攻击的风险。
其次,不要将API密钥存储在公开的代码库或共享平台上。最好将密钥保存在本地安全的地方,并确保只有必要的应用程序能够访问。
第三,选择经过验证的交易平台至关重要。用户应查看平台的安全性声明、历史安全事件和客户反馈,确保选择的交易平台技术成熟,安全可靠。
最后,了解并关注API的调用日志。如果发现异常调用记录,应立即更改API密钥,防止被非法利用。
#### 3. 是否所有的交易平台都有API接口?尽管越来越多的交易平台开始开放API接口,但并不是所有平台都有此功能。一些小型或新兴的交易所可能缺乏API接入,限制了交易者的交易方式。
大型交易平台如Binance、Coinbase、Kraken等都提供功能强大的API接口,支持各种交易功能,包括市场实时数据、账户管理、订单匹配等。
在选择交易所时,用户应优先考虑那些提供正式API文档的交易平台。公开透明的API文档可以不仅帮助开发者快速上手,还能为用户提供一定的信心。
尽管某些小型平台可能没有API,但有些平台却可能提供REST API接口,允许用户进行基本查询和委托功能。因此,在选择交易平台时,查看其技术文档是非常重要的。
#### 4. 如何处理API调用的错误?在使用虚拟币交易接口时,交易者可能会遇到多种错误,如网络问题、权限设置错误或API调用频率超限等。
处理这些错误的第一步是理解每种错误的含义。API通常会返回特定的错误代码,通过阅读文档来判断哪些是常见错误。
此外,添加错误处理逻辑可以降低对交易策略的影响。例如,对于临时的网络错误,可以设置重试机制,让程序在指定时间内重新请求API。
用户也可以通过监控API调用的日志来及时发现问题。定期检查调用频次和错误率,有助于及早发现并处理潜在的系统问题。
最后,用户应保持与交易平台的联系,了解其API服务状态,关注是否有维护通知,以避免在关键时刻面临无法使用API的局面。
#### 5. 交易接口的使用费用如何影响盈利?虚拟币交易接口的使用费用包括交易手续费、提现费用以及API调用费用。对于频繁交易的用户,手续费的高低直接影响到交易成本和整体盈利能力。
不同交易平台的手续费结构各有不同。一些平台可能采用固定比例的佣金,而另一些则可能根据用户的交易量给予折扣。用户应在选择平台前,仔细阅读相关的费用说明。
虽然某些平台提供免费API接口,但可能会收取高额的交易手续费。因此,在选择平台时,综合考量费用结构是至关重要的。
此外,使用API进行高频交易且迅速完成交易的策略较为常见,用户在制定该策略时,需考虑交易接口的相应费用,以确保盈利空间充足。
总体来说,交易费用会直接影响所获收益,确保熟知平台费用制度对于交易成功至关重要,避免因费用过高而造成不必要的损失。
#### 6. 如何用API实现自动化交易?自动化交易是利用API接口实现的一种交易策略,旨在通过程序化的方式快速执行交易策略,降低人工干预。
首先,用户需注册并获取交易平台的API密钥,确保程序能够安全地访问账户。然后,通过编程语言(如Python)编写脚本,在指定条件下进行买入或卖出操作。
用户可以利用技术分析工具,编写算法交易策略,该策略会监控市场行情并自动执行指令。例如,当某个币种的价格达到设定的阈值,就会自动触发买入或卖出。
自动化交易的优势在于可以减少情绪干扰,提高交易效率和执行速度。通过程序化的方式,用户能够利用市场微小的波动,实现量化交易。
然而,自动化交易也有一定风险,尤其是在市场波动剧烈时。建议用户在测试阶段,使用模拟账户以验证交易策略的有效性,确保风险可控。
通过这些详细的问题介绍,我们希望能够为交易者提供更全面的知识,帮助他们在虚拟币交易中更好地利用API接口,实现更高效和安全的交易。
leave a reply